PALM OR PASSION SUNDAY marks the start of Holy Week. The RCL has readings for each day of the week.
Many churches where I live do not have services for every day of Holy Week but that does not stop you from gathering the family and looking into the readings.
What a lovely way to prepare the family for Good Friday.
You can read all the texts or just choose one or two for the day.
These ideas are for your family to think through, they are not intended for you to be all knowing (you may actually be surprised what ideas are sparked in your children about faith.)
This is a time for you all to get to know the Lord.
LITURGY FOR LENT
Lent is 40 Days, (spread your fingers out and push them in front of yourself 4X)
it’s a long long way (shield your eyes and look around the horizon)
but with each step (walk on the spot)
We get closer,
closer to the JOY of EASTER, (star jump)
Closer to God (give yourself a hug)
We learn more about ourselves (point to yourself)
Like Jesus did in his 40 days in the Wilderness,
Today we only have 4 days left (spread your fingers out and count off 4 fingers)
We are getting closer
So today we wave (wave)
with Palm leaves high (if you have a palm leaf real or created hold it up high)
Amen (one clap)
(Some visual learning suggestions, place 40 stepping stones around the church/or home, these can be made from non-slip tiles or mats (try Bunnings or Spotlight for ideas) such as these or if your church/home has cobble stones or timber stepping stones around them, number them and cross off the days. Another option is to use the Praying in Color steps template, especially good for those with small spaces or where you want people to stay connected away from the communal space.)
NOTE: though we say that LENT is 40 days we do not count the Sundays

PSALM 36:5-11
Your love, O God, reaches up, up beyond the sky, (stretch as tall as you can, arms above your head)
Your goodness goes higher than the clouds, (shade your eyes)
Your power is bigger than the tallest mountains, ( bring your hands together above your head)
Your truth goes deeper than the ocean. (wiggle your hand like waves on the sea)
O God, we treasure your infinite love. (make a love heart with your hands)
All people can hide in the shadow of your wings. (flap your arms like wings)
O God, we celebrate your mighty river of joy. (star jump)
All people can feast together in your house. (pretend to spoon food into your mouth)
O God, you are the fountain of life. (hold arms out wide above your body)
All people can find light in your light. (shield your eyes)
Your love, O God, reaches up, up beyond the sky, (stretch as tall as you can, arms above your head)
Your goodness goes higher than the clouds, (shade your eyes)
Your power is bigger than the tallest mountains, ( bring your hands together above your head)
Your truth goes deeper than the ocean. (wiggle your hand like waves on the sea)
Hold us in your amazing love, now and forever. (Make a love heart with your hands)
With loving hearts we will live in you. Amen. (clap once)
adapted from Rev Purdie’s rewite of Psalm 36, with actions in italics from me.
How does the Psalm make you feel?
Describe that feeling, or draw it, or point out what it feels like from a set of emotional cards https://innovativeresources.org/resources/card-sets/bears-cards/ or the Bears App https://innovativeresources.org/resources/digital-applications/bears-app/
